Actually, I just tested it and there's a third factor I'd forgotten about - EVERY civ (Imperialistic or not) gets an intrinsic +100% Great General point bonus when fighting inside their territory. This bonus isn't really documented very well, so it's easy to forget about.
The full (corrected) table would be:
No Imp, No Great Wall, battle outside home territory => 1 XP gives 1 XP on GG bar
No Imp, No Great Wall, battle inside home territory => 1 XP gives 2 XP on GG bar (+100%)
No Imp, Great Wall, battle outside home territory => 1 XP gives 1 XP on GG bar
No Imp, Great Wall, battle inside home territory => 1 XP gives 3 XP on GG bar (+200%)
Imp, No Great Wall, battle outside home territory => 1 XP gives 2 XP on GG bar (+100%)
Imp, No Great Wall, battle inside home territory => 1 XP gives 3 XP on GG bar (+200%)
Imp, Great Wall, battle outside home territory => 1 XP gives 2 XP on GG bar (+100%)
Imp, Great Wall, battle inside home territory => 1 XP gives 4 XP on GG bar (+300%)
This is confirmed with in-game testing.
